18 commitment accounting
Fina method of accounting which recognizes expenditure as soon as it is contracted -
19 commitment document
Fina contract, change order, purchase order, or letter of intent pertaining to the supply of goods and services that commits an organization to legal, financial, and other obligations -
20 commitment fee
Fina fee that a lender charges to guarantee a rate of interest on a loan a borrower is soon to make.
